The MSc Advanced Computer Networks offers students advanced theory and hands-on skills in designing, securing, operating and troubleshooting enterprise-scale network infrastructures. It’s suited to both networking enthusiasts and professionals who want to deepen their knowledge in areas such as enterprise routing & switching, automation, cybersecurity, and Cisco technologies.
Curriculum Structure
Since this is a one-year full-time master’s (or up to 2 years with the work-experience option), students move quickly into advanced modules: they take Advanced Switching and Routing, Enterprise Network Infrastructure and Troubleshooting, Network Design and Automation, Network Security and Cyberops, and Research Methods and Strategies. They also complete a Dissertation for Cyber Security and Computer Networks, giving chance to specialise via research or an industry case study, consolidating both technical and analytical skills.

Professional Alignment (Accreditation)
The course is part of the Cisco Networking Academy, and the fee includes attempts at relevant Cisco CCNP-level exams (ENCOR, ENARSI) as part of the curriculum.
